A capacitance method is applied to measure the space-averaged void fraction in concentric annular flows. From the analytical solution of the governing electrical field equations, the expression for the capacitance in terms of a given void fraction is derived. Also, a closed form formula to predict the void fraction from the capacitance measurement is proposed. The relationship between the capacitance and the void fraction is successfully compared with static phantom experiments.
